On today’s episode, the crew reacts to the NBA suspending Draymond Green for game three against the Sacramento Kings after he stomped on Domantas Sabonis’ chest in game two. Then, they discuss the Phoenix Suns evening up the series against the Los Angeles Clippers at 1-1 behind a combined 63 points from Kevin Durant and Devin Booker, the confidence level for the Suns after game two, and how long they believe the series will go. Next, they talk about the Cleveland Cavaliers holding the New York Knicks to just 90 points in the game two win, the difference between that performance vs. game one, and their picks to win the series. After that, they touch on the Boston Celtics handily beating the Atlanta Hawks to take a 2-0 series lead, are the Celtics the best team in the East, if the Hawks take a game when the series returns to Atlanta, and if Trae Young is overrated. Finally, the crew previews Wednesday’s game two matchups between the Lakers-Grizzlies, Heat-Bucks, and Timberwolves-Nuggets.
